Job description

Job Summary and Responsibilities

As our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N), you will help our patients by providing nursing care to our skilled nursing residents under the direction of the physician or registered nurse. Every day you will work with our patients to evaluate their needs and provide physical or psychosocial care. To be successful in this role, you must have a genuine compassion for your patients’ well-being and understand the role you play in helping our our patients feel at ease. You also have the patience to explain the process, answer questions and update documentation.

  • Patient Admissions & Care Planning: Collaborates with the Charge Nurse on admission orders and medication sheets, assists in developing and updating care plans based on patient condition changes
  • Patient Assessment & Reporting: Performs assessments when notified of patient condition changes, reporting findings to the Charge Nurse and providers as requested
  • Medication Management: Dispenses oral medications, administers IV, IM, and subcutaneous medications under RN supervision, reports medication errors, conducts narcotic counts, and gives inhalation therapy
  • Discharges & Care Level Changes: Notifies pharmacy of patient status changes, supervises patient/caregiver education, arranges follow-up care, removes devices, and ensures home medications are returned during discharge
  • Emergency Care & Skills: Assists in ER/treatment room care, gathers patient information, calls for additional help during emergencies, and performs skilled procedures like IVs, catheterization, and dressing changes under RN supervision
  • Documentation & Infection Control: Completes all necessary documentation, including medication, treatment, and acute/swing bed conditions, maintains patient Kardex, performs safety checks, and logs/reports infectious incidents while ensuring isolation precautions

Where You'll Work

CHI St. Alexius Health Garrison includes the services of a 22-bed critical access hospital, a 26-bed skilled nursing facility, an attached rural health clinic, and an Emergency Department that is available 24 hours a day. We offer many outpatient services, including physical therapy, radiology services, laboratory services, cardiac rehabilitation, and IV treatments. Since opening in 1952, CHI St. Alexius Health Garrison has been dedicated to serving the residents of Garrison and the surrounding rural communities. The hospital is equipped with 4 emergency rooms, on-site lab, radiology, CT and physical therapy services. Our patients have access to 24/7 emergency care, swing-bed program, and acute care services.
